Output 65dc8f3c99a54b90b87adf8763e25c2a067e2a8343b42aa5edb40d3180128492: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c6856ee4cfbb494351b2ce0b07ab878f7584ef OP_EQUAL
address
3GFqBYLsLgKxJvjtij4TYAgbkKbbW56pFw
transaction
65dc8f3c99a54b90b87adf8763e25c2a067e2a8343b42aa5edb40d3180128492
confirmations
487918
spent
true